The genus for hamsters is Mesocricetus and it belongs to rodents. Hamsters belong to the Cricetidae family.
Rodents are mammals belonging to the Order Rodentia characterized by a pair of continuously growing incisors in their upper/lower jaws.
In turn, Cricetidae is a family of rodents that belongs to the Muroidea superfamily.
Cricetidae rodent species include, among others, hamsters (genus Mesocricetus), lemmings, rats and mice.
